Vespa GTS 300 IE Super vs Derbi Rambla 300i — which should you buy?
Picking between the Vespa GTS 300 IE Super and the Derbi Rambla 300i usually comes down to the numbers you care about most. On paper, the Vespa GTS 300 IE Super brings 21 hp in a 148 kg package, while the Derbi Rambla 300i counters with 23 hp at 146 kg. On price, the Derbi Rambla 300i has the lower MSRP.
